A guy came to my door one evening, rang the doorbell and gave me a card. He said a neighbor was a regular customer and offered to do my house the next day for $225. I agreed and when he returned he did my house and I let him do my deck for an additional $250. He mentioned several times that he pulled a 22 foot trailer which I guess he thinks makes him seem more legitimate. I never saw the trailer. He washed the house by spraying on bleach/water/soap solution and then waiting and rinsing with water. I wanted my deck stained after cleaning and he wanted to do that also. He gave me a price but I chose a legitimate painting contractor who does work for local builders. I did not tell Mr Hobbs because I thought he would do a better job on the deck if he thought he might get to apply the stain. He leaves his empty bleach bottles, boxes and dish detergent bottles strewn about the yard. Between the house and deck work he left his equipment in the yard, spray wand on the deck and hose attached. It took him about an hour to do my house and two hours to do my deck. He was supposed to return and finish the deck at 7:30 am the following day but showed up just before 10 am and sits in his older Tahoe and talks on his phone. He kept pestering me about staining my deck for which he wanted $1300. I told him I had his card and would call him if I decided to use him. I was glad to have him leave my property. I watched him the next day doing other houses in the neighborhood and talked with a couple of his clients. They were satisfied with his work but I doubt they knew how quickly he finished. I checked the BBB and noticed he had had a couple of complaints and I decided to join Angie's List to avoid similar situations in the future . The painting contractor gave me an estimate to stain my deck that was about half what Mr Hobbs had wanted. Then last night my doorbell rang and Mr Hobbs was there and asked if I had decided on his staining offer. I told him I had chosen someone else and he started questioning my judgement and ran down the quality of work I would get. He wanted to know the price I would pay and when I refused to tell him he said "well at least he took $500 from me for about three hours of work". I think I learned a lesson and I seriously doubt I will do business with anyone with out checking them out first. Update 11/21/13 Noticed after having deck stained that Mr Hobbs damaged numerous boards where he used too much force and curled up grain and splintered surface of boards. I have also found places on the back of my house that he missed washing.
Description of Work: Washed my home and pressure washed my deck.

First, whatever you do....do not use this guy to do anything in or outside your home!! He is such a fraud it is actually comical. He a bumbling fast talking idiot who knows nothing about the profession he is in. He goes door to door passing out his business cards for "Troy Hobbs Pressure Washing & More". Along with pressure washing, he claims to do privacy fences, carpeting, painting, etc. Considering I have been wanting to get my house pressure washed for a couple weeks and I work nights and dont have the time to do myself, I decided to take him up on his offer of $200 to pressure wash my entire 2 story house, top to bottom, squeaky clean after I saw the work he had done on my neighbors house a couple days earlier. He will claim to have a 50 foot wand (attachment to the hose which will allow him to reach second story gutters and what not), a big trailer with his own water and other supplies. He will claim that he has been doing this for several years and he will have your house done in 2 hours. Well, he showed up the next day with a typical pressure washer on wheels with a standard 4 foot wand, with no trailer, no hose, and 7 gallons of bleach. He hooked up to my water faucet, used my hose, and went to work. I was so dumbfounded that I really had to watch this idiot to see what he would do. An hour and a half later he was done and I have to admit, 95% of the house was just as clean as can be, but he used straight bleach as a soaking mechanism on the house and after letting it sit, he would rinse. Obviously, this is not good for your lawn, plants, children, & pets. He will tell you he cant tell you what he uses to clean the house but when there are 7 empty buckets of bleach laying in your yard along with some dawn detergent....go figure...he even threw them in my trashcan. Being somewhat surprised how quick he did the job, I gave him a little $15 tip and sent him on his way still flabbergasted at the stupidity of this guy. I dont happen to have any children, pets, or plants right underneath the roof line so I didnt sweat the bleach too much. I happened to notice the next day that there was still some mildew and black mold along my second story roof above a screened in back porch we have on the back side of the house. I called him and asked him if he didnt mind swinging by (considering I gave him a little tip) with a ladder or his "50 foot" wand and touch it up for me because the reason the mold was still there is because he couldnt get enough pressure from the ground to eliminate it with his little 4 foot wand. He said that I told him the day before that I was satisfied with the job, he doesnt get on ladders, that he actually used an extension and admitted to using straight bleach and he still couldnt get it off. He said he wasnt a "miracle worker" and that the mildew and black stuff on that 2nd story gutter above my back porch was tar from the roof and mildew which was baked in by the sun. Seriously....hes an idiot. I decided to part ways and let it go as I wont be using him again. To add to this story, my neighbors flagged me down yesterday complaining about him and how he gave them the same story, showed up with the same stuff and actually didnt rinse the house well enough so there were bleach run marks all over their siding. My neighbor had to get his own pressure washer out and rinse it again himself. Nevertheless, if you want to hire a guy who lies about the equipment that he has, that will jeopardize the health of your lawn, plants, children, & pets, and who has absolutely no clue about what he is doing.....then be my guest and use him!! However, if you do, you will be sorry!!
Description of Work: Pressure Washed My House
